7.2.8.1. pipe and Fittings

(1) pipes and fittings to be used for drainage and venting ="http://thehandyforce.com/interior/bathroom-renovations/" title ="Toronto Bathroom renovation inspiration">venting of acid and corrosive wastes shall conform to,

(a) ASTM A518/A518M, "Corrosion-Resistant High-Silicon Iron Castings",

(b) ASTM C1053, "Boronsilicate glass pipe and Fittings for Drain, Waste, and vent (DWV) applications", or

(c) CAN/CSA-B181.3, "Polyolefin and Polyvinylidene Fluoride (PVDF) Laboratory drainage Systems".

In Plain Language

Pipe and fittings used for drainage and venting of acid and corrosive waste must meet material requirements specifically suited to resisting that chemical exposure, distinct from the standard sanitary drainage material rules.
